#277da2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#277da2 is composed of 15.3% red, 49%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.9% cyan, 22.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 198 degrees, a saturation of 61.2% and a lightness of 39.4%. #277da2 color hex could be obtained by blending #4efaff with #000045.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#277da2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#277da2 has RGB values of R:39, G:125,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 2588066.
